Q: When a stable molecule is formed what is the configuration of its atoms' outer shells?

How are covalent bonds formed?

Covalent bonds are formed when two atoms share electrons in order to achieve a stable electron configuration. This sharing allows both atoms to fill their valence shells and attain a more stable state. Covalent bonds are typically formed between nonmetal atoms.

Elements with complete outer shells?

Elements with complete outer shells have a full valence shell of electrons and are stable. This configuration is typically achieved by having eight electrons in the outer shell (known as the octet rule) or two electrons for the first shell. These elements are generally inert or have low reactivity due to their stable electron configuration.

Explain what atoms are trying to achieve in there electron shells when they bond with each outher?

Atoms are trying achieve a stable electronic configuration i.e., stable arrangement of electrons in their electron shells. All configurations are not stable. Mostly stable configuration is attained by forming an octet of electrons in outer most shell. Sometimes octet rule is violated also.

Why noble gases so stable?

Noble gases are chemically stable because they have completely filled electron orbitals. They generally have 8 valence electrons (helium has only 2) and therefore have a stable electronic configuration.
